Windows Server 2003 Internet Gateways

Course Summary

Throughout this Windows Server 2003 Internet Gateways course you will learn how to establish internet connectivity on your network using ISA Server, NAT and ICS, so you can evaluate and implement the best solution depending on your network's needs.
